The Science Behind The Procedure
Healite II uses light therapy to increase blood flow, relax muscles
and rejuvenate your skin.
Deep penetrating LED lights target deep into skin cells to stimulate
collagen and elastin. This treatment continues to work under the
skin for the next 48 hours, leaving your skin radiant,
energised and rejuvenated.
Healite II uses three key wavelengths:
- 830nm infrared light – penetrates deepest for wound healing,
muscle relief, lymphatic drainage, and post-treatment recovery - 633nm red light – boosts blood flow, collagen factories (aka fibroblasts),
and combats superficial skin lesions and signs of ageing - 415nm blue light – kills acne-causing bacteria and reduces
acne congestion and inflammation
The result? Cellular activity is supercharged, skin recovery is faster,
and the appearance of skin visibly improves — all without thermal damage or discomfort.

Contraindications to Healite II
As gentle as Healite is, there are some conditions where we’ll hold off:
- Photosensitive epilepsy
- Use of photosensitising medications (e.g. Roaccutane)
- Skin cancers or suspicious lesions in treatment areas
- Open wounds or active infections
- Clients with light sensitivity from autoimmune or genetic conditions
If in doubt, we’ll always perform a comprehensive skin consultation.

Step-by-Step Treatment
What to Expect During a Healite II Session
A Healite II session is completely non-contact and deeply relaxing. Here’s what to expect:
- Your skin is cleansed
- The LED panel is positioned 5–10cm from the skin (no direct contact)
- You relax under the bright light for 10–20 minutes, depending on your treatment plan
- You can return to normal daily activities immediately after — no downtime, no irritation
We may pair it with other aesthetic treatments like peels, dermal fillers, or
thread lifts to enhance results and support your healing process.

Cost
Pricing Guide
At most Australian clinics:
- Standalone sessions range from $70–$120
- Add-on LED treatments with a facial treatment or peel: $40–$60
- Packages (6+ sessions): $350–$600, depending on your plan
